Abstract
The invention discloses an earthing clamp. The earthing clamp comprises a support, a sliding support and a driving device, wherein a fixed clamp head is arranged at the upper end of the support; the sliding support is arranged on the support in the mode of being capable of vertically sliding, a sliding clamp head is arranged at the upper end of the sliding support; the driving device is used for driving the sliding support to slide. The driving device comprises a rack, a first gear, a bearing, a second gear, a swing support and a rotating mechanism, wherein the rack is fixedly arranged on the sliding support; the first gear is arranged on the support, and is connected with the rack in a meshed mode; the bearing is clamped and embedded into an arc-shaped groove formed in the support in the mode of being capable of sliding; a main shaft of the second gear is arranged on the bearing in a sleeving mode, and the second gear is connected with the first gear in a meshed mode; the swing support is arranged on the support in the mode of being capable of rotating, and is locked to the support through a locking mechanism; a main shaft of the second gear is arranged on the swing support in a sleeving mode; the rotating mechanism is arranged on the swing support and is used for driving the main shaft of the second gear to rotate. The earthing clamp is simple in structure, good in self-locking performance and convenient to operate.

Background technology
When being overhauled to high pressure equipment or high-voltage line or during other work, high pressure equipment or high-voltage line passed through into earth lead
Folder is connected with ground wire, can prevent dangerous voltage and electric arc or neighbouring other high voltage alive equipments of the equipment suddenly produced by incoming call
Harm of the induced voltage to human body is produced with circuit, it may also be used for drain the residual charge of power cutoff device and circuit, it is to avoid personnel
Generation electric shock accidentss, to ensure the personal safety of operating personnel.Therefore, high pressure equipment or high-voltage line are carried out by earthing clamp
Short-circuit grounding wire is a very important electrical safety measurement.But, existing earthing clamp is poor due to self-locking performance, in operation
It is possible to that earthing clamp can be caused to come off during human users, if operating personnel can not have found in time, service work meeting
Safeguard protection is lost, accident is susceptible to.Also there is the self-locking performance of some earthing clamps preferably, but its complex structure, operating personnel
In-convenience in use.

As shown in Figure 1 to Figure 3, it is according to a kind of embodiment of the specific embodiment of the invention:A kind of earthing clamp, its bag
Support 1, travelling carriage 2, fixed chuck 3, sliding clamp 4 and driving means are included, wherein:
As shown in figure 1, fixed chuck 3 is arranged at the upper end of support 1, travelling carriage 2 is arranged in the way of it can slide up and down
On support 1, the upper end of travelling carriage 2 is provided with a sliding clamp 4 corresponding with fixed chuck 3.Preferably, the He of fixed chuck 3
Sliding clamp 4 is arranged at respectively the upper end of support 1 and travelling carriage 2 in the way of it can dismantle, due to fixed chuck 3 and slip clamp
4 can dismantle, therefore the high pressure equipment or high-voltage line that can be directed to different model changes different fixed chucks 3 and sliding clamp
4, to improve the suitability of the present invention.
Driving means are used to drive travelling carriage 2 to be slided up and down along support 1, to control sliding clamp 4 and fixation clamp
Opening and closing between 3, so as to realize the clamping to high pressure equipment or high-voltage line.As shown in figure 1, driving means include:Tooth bar 21,
First gear 22, second gear 23, bearing 24, swing span 5 and rotating mechanism, tooth bar 21 is fixedly installed on travelling carriage 2, the
One gear 22 is rotatably arranged on support 1, and first gear 22 is engaged with tooth bar 21 and is connected.Such as Fig. 1
With shown in Fig. 2, support 1 is arranged with an arc groove 11 in the periphery of first gear 22, it is preferable that the angle of arc groove 11 is 90
Degree, i.e., it is quarter circular arc.Bearing 24 in the way of it can slide inlay card in arc groove 11, it can be along arc groove
11 slide.The collar bush of second gear 23 is on bearing 24, and second gear 23 is connected with the engagement of first gear 22.Second tooth
Wheel 23 can drive first gear 22 to rotate, to drive travelling carriage 2 to be slided up and down by tooth bar 21.And second gear 23 and
Its main shaft can integrally as bearing 24 enters line slip along arc groove 11.
As shown in figures 1 and 3, swing span 5 is rotatably arranged on support 1, when swinging, pendulum
Moving frame 5 is lock onto 1 on support by a retaining mechanism.The main shaft of second gear 23 is rotatably sheathed on swing span
On 5, when swing span 5 is rotated, it can drive second gear 23 and bearing 24 along circle by the main shaft of second gear 23
Arc groove 11 enters line slip.Preferably, a swing handle 51 is convexly equipped with swing span, operating personnel is by 51 pairs of swings of swing handle
Frame 5 is swung manually.It is further preferred that retaining mechanism is a holding screw 52 being set up on swing span, support 1 is arranged
Have one with the corresponding arc-shaped edges of holding screw 52 along 12, after swing span 5 is swung to specified location, by tightening clamp screw
Nail 52 is pressed in arc-shaped edges along 12, so that swing span 5 is lock onto on support 1.
Rotating mechanism is arranged on swing span 5, and rotating mechanism is used to drive the main shaft of second gear 23 to be rotated.It is excellent
Selection of land, as shown in Figures 2 and 3, rotating mechanism includes worm gear 25 and worm screw 26, and worm gear 25 is arranged at the main shaft of second gear 23
On, worm screw 26 is arranged on swing span 1, and the worm screw 26 is engaged with worm gear 25 and is connected.Operating personnel passes through rotary worm
26 just can enable travelling carriage 2 along support 1 by the transmission of worm gear 25, second gear 23, first gear 22 and tooth bar 21
Slided up and down.
Inventive drive means simple structure, easy to use, it can be according to specific working environment come by swinging
Frame 2 changes the position of rotating mechanism, so that operating personnel can operate fixed chuck 3 and sliding clamp from suitable position
4 opening and closing, and the present invention be driven by pinion and rack and worm-and-wheel gear, it has good self-lock ability,
Ensure that the present invention can be stably clamped on high pressure equipment or high-voltage line, its fool proof reliability.
